RE: Wigglesworth's Shosty Babi Yar half off at eclassical, but will the trees look sternly enough?

I bought this recording when it came out. The sound reproduction is outstanding, especially in mch surround. The performance is also excellent, but it is nowhere as powerful as the Kondrashin recording with Artur Eizen (which has better sound than the one with Gromadsky singing).

The Eizen/Kondrashin version uses the "softened" text that makes the first movement not so clearly about anti-Semitism. As a non-Russian speaker, that doesn't matter to me, because I know what the poet and the composer intended. I don't know if any recordings other than Kondrashin's Soviet performances use that expurgated text.
